Wood Decking and Traditional Options

Wood has long been a favorite for patio deck floor covering, offering a warm, organic look that blends seamlessly with many architectural styles. Traditional options like pressure treated lumber provide an affordable entry point, while premium species such as cedar and redwood deliver natural resistance to rot and insects. These materials bring a classic charm to outdoor spaces, and with regular sealing, they can maintain their beauty for many years.

Homeowners who value the authentic feel of natural wood often appreciate the ability to customize stain colors and finishes, creating a truly personalized look. However, wood does require ongoing maintenance, including cleaning, staining, and occasional repairs to prevent splintering and weather damage. Choosing the right grade of lumber and proper installation techniques can significantly extend its lifespan and keep your patio deck floor covering looking its best.

Capped Composite and Low Maintenance Alternatives

Capped composite decking has emerged as a popular alternative to traditional wood, combining recycled materials with a protective polymer shell to deliver exceptional durability. This patio deck floor covering option resists fading, staining, and scratching, making it ideal for busy households that prioritize low maintenance. The capped surface also helps repel moisture, reducing the risk of mold and mildew growth in humid climates.

Beyond composites, engineered wood products like grooved ECP offer the look of real wood with improved stability and resistance to expansion and contraction. These materials are designed to withstand temperature fluctuations and heavy foot traffic, providing a practical long term solution for outdoor spaces. Homeowners benefit from a wide range of colors and textures, allowing for a high end aesthetic without the intensive upkeep associated with natural hardwoods.

Modern Hardscaping and Design Focused Solutions

For those seeking a more contemporary look, hardscaping materials such as concrete, pavers, and porcelain tiles present versatile patio deck floor covering ideas that emphasize clean lines and sophistication. Stamped concrete allows for intricate patterns that mimic stone, brick, or slate at a fraction of the cost, while also offering exceptional durability in high traffic areas.

Interlocking pavers and modular tile systems provide flexibility and drainage benefits, making them suitable for areas prone to heavy rain or shifting soil. These materials can be arranged in herringbone, running bond, or circular patterns, adding visual interest and enhancing the overall design of your outdoor space. With a thoughtful selection of colors and layout, hardscaping options can transform a plain patio into a stunning architectural feature.

Brick, Stone, and Natural Material Patterns

Brick and natural stone remain timeless choices for patio deck floor covering, bringing an enduring sense of elegance and permanence to outdoor living areas. With options like flagstone, bluestone, and travertine, each installation becomes unique, as the natural variations in texture and color create a distinctive pattern. These materials are incredibly durable and can handle harsh weather conditions when properly installed on a stable base.

Designers often recommend incorporating contrasting grout colors or mixing stone sizes to create depth and character, turning a simple patio into a curated landscape element. While stone work can involve a higher initial investment, its longevity and timeless appeal often make it a worthwhile choice for homeowners focused on long term value and upscale curb appeal.

Porcelain Tiles and High Performance Surfaces

Advancements in manufacturing have made porcelain tiles a strong contender for patio deck floor covering, especially for those who desire the look of ceramic or stone without compromising performance. These tiles are fired at higher temperatures, resulting in a dense, non porous surface that resists water absorption, staining, and fading.

Large format porcelain slabs create a seamless appearance, reducing the number of grout lines and making cleaning more straightforward. Many modern porcelain tiles also feature textured finishes for improved slip resistance, ensuring safety in wet conditions. For homeowners in colder regions, frost proof porcelain options provide reliable performance through freeze thaw cycles without cracking or chipping.

Creative Patterns, Layouts, and Decorative Enhancements

Beyond material selection, the way you arrange your patio deck floor covering can dramatically influence the character of your outdoor space. Herringbone and basketweave patterns introduce classic elegance, while linear layouts with elongated planks can make a small patio feel more expansive. Mixing materials, such as pairing wood decking with stone accents, adds contrast and defines separate functional zones for seating, dining, and lounging.

Bold designs, like mosaics inlays or circular focal points, draw the eye and create a sense of artistry underfoot. These creative approaches allow you to express your personal style while optimizing the layout for traffic flow and furniture placement. Thoughtful pattern choices can turn the floor covering into a design statement that enhances the entire backyard retreat.

Integrating lighting, borders, and transitional elements further elevates the visual impact of your chosen materials. LED strips beneath raised decking or discreet pathway lights improve safety at night, while complementary trim and edging define the space. By combining decorative touches with functional considerations, you achieve a cohesive look that feels both polished and welcoming.

Climate Considerations and Long Term Durability

Your local climate plays a crucial role in determining which patio deck floor covering ideas will stand the test of time. In regions with intense sunlight, materials with high UV resistance, such as capped composites and porcelain tiles, help prevent fading and surface degradation. Conversely, areas with frequent rain and temperature swings benefit from materials that resist warping, swelling, and slipping.

For colder climates, it is wise to choose products that are specifically rated for freeze thaw conditions, ensuring that the surface remains stable through seasonal shifts. Proper installation techniques, including adequate drainage and a stable base, are essential regardless of material choice. By prioritizing climate appropriate solutions, you protect your investment and enjoy consistent performance year after year.

Maintenance requirements also vary widely, from simple occasional sweeping and rinsing to periodic sealing and professional cleaning for natural stone. Understanding these commitments upfront allows you to choose a patio deck floor covering that fits both your aesthetic desires and your available time for upkeep. With the right balance of beauty, durability, and care, your outdoor surface can remain a central gathering spot for years to come.
